From 106d8b6457ce5144c6affd6bce701e8d0e7a7662 Mon Sep 17 00:00:00 2001
From: "dependabot[bot]" <49699333+dependabot[bot]@users.noreply.github.com>
Date: Mon, 19 Aug 2024 19:34:03 +0000
Subject: [PATCH] Bump the all group across 1 directory with 7 updates

Bumps the all group with 6 updates in the /local-registry directory:

| Package | From | To |
| --- | --- | --- |
| [arrayvec](https://github.com/bluss/arrayvec) | `0.7.4` | `0.7.6` |
| [derive_more](https://github.com/JelteF/derive_more) | `0.99.18` | `1.0.0` |
| [indexmap](https://github.com/indexmap-rs/indexmap) | `2.3.0` | `2.4.0` |
| [ndarray](https://github.com/rust-ndarray/ndarray) | `0.15.6` | `0.16.1` |
| [rstest](https://github.com/la10736/rstest) | `0.21.0` | `0.22.0` |
| [serde](https://github.com/serde-rs/serde) | `1.0.204` | `1.0.208` |



Updates `arrayvec` from 0.7.4 to 0.7.6
- [Release notes](https://github.com/bluss/arrayvec/releases)
- [Changelog](https://github.com/bluss/arrayvec/blob/master/CHANGELOG.md)
- [Commits](https://github.com/bluss/arrayvec/compare/0.7.4...0.7.6)

Updates `derive_more` from 0.99.18 to 1.0.0
- [Release notes](https://github.com/JelteF/derive_more/releases)
- [Changelog](https://github.com/JelteF/derive_more/blob/master/CHANGELOG.md)
- [Commits](https://github.com/JelteF/derive_more/compare/v0.99.18...v1.0.0)

Updates `indexmap` from 2.3.0 to 2.4.0
- [Changelog](https://github.com/indexmap-rs/indexmap/blob/master/RELEASES.md)
- [Commits](https://github.com/indexmap-rs/indexmap/compare/2.3.0...2.4.0)

Updates `ndarray` from 0.15.6 to 0.16.1
- [Release notes](https://github.com/rust-ndarray/ndarray/releases)
- [Changelog](https://github.com/rust-ndarray/ndarray/blob/master/RELEASES.md)
- [Commits](https://github.com/rust-ndarray/ndarray/compare/0.15.6...0.16.1)

Updates `rstest` from 0.21.0 to 0.22.0
- [Release notes](https://github.com/la10736/rstest/releases)
- [Changelog](https://github.com/la10736/rstest/blob/master/CHANGELOG.md)
- [Commits](https://github.com/la10736/rstest/compare/v0.21.0...v0.22.0)

Updates `serde` from 1.0.204 to 1.0.208
- [Release notes](https://github.com/serde-rs/serde/releases)
- [Commits](https://github.com/serde-rs/serde/compare/v1.0.204...v1.0.208)

Updates `serde_derive` from 1.0.204 to 1.0.208
- [Release notes](https://github.com/serde-rs/serde/releases)
- [Commits](https://github.com/serde-rs/serde/compare/v1.0.204...v1.0.208)

---
updated-dependencies:
- dependency-name: arrayvec
  dependency-type: direct:production
  update-type: version-update:semver-patch
  dependency-group: all
- dependency-name: derive_more
  dependency-type: direct:production
  update-type: version-update:semver-major
  dependency-group: all
- dependency-name: indexmap
  dependency-type: direct:production
  update-type: version-update:semver-minor
  dependency-group: all
- dependency-name: ndarray
  dependency-type: direct:production
  update-type: version-update:semver-minor
  dependency-group: all
- dependency-name: rstest
  dependency-type: direct:production
  update-type: version-update:semver-minor
  dependency-group: all
- dependency-name: serde
  dependency-type: direct:production
  update-type: version-update:semver-patch
  dependency-group: all
- dependency-name: serde_derive
  dependency-type: direct:production
  update-type: version-update:semver-patch
  dependency-group: all
...

Signed-off-by: dependabot[bot] <support@github.com>
---
 local-registry/Cargo.lock | 68 +++++++++++++++++++++++++--------------
 local-registry/Cargo.toml | 12 +++----
 2 files changed, 49 insertions(+), 31 deletions(-)

diff --git a/local-registry/Cargo.lock b/local-registry/Cargo.lock
index a92d688..b88f9d0 100644
--- a/local-registry/Cargo.lock
+++ b/local-registry/Cargo.lock
@@ -97,9 +97,9 @@ dependencies = [
 
 [[package]]
 name = "arrayvec"
-version = "0.7.4"
+version = "0.7.6"
 source = "registry+https://github.com/rust-lang/crates.io-index"
-checksum = "96d30a06541fbafbc7f82ed10c06164cfbd2c401138f6addd8404629c4b16711"
+checksum = "7c02d123df017efcdfbd739ef81735b36c5ba83ec3c59c80a9d7ecc718f92e50"
 
 [[package]]
 name = "ascii"
@@ -359,12 +359,6 @@ version = "0.1.0"
 source = "registry+https://github.com/rust-lang/crates.io-index"
 checksum = "120133d4db2ec47efe2e26502ee984747630c67f51974fca0b6c1340cf2368d3"
 
-[[package]]
-name = "convert_case"
-version = "0.4.0"
-source = "registry+https://github.com/rust-lang/crates.io-index"
-checksum = "6245d59a3e82a7fc217c5828a6692dbc6dfb63a0c8c90495621f7b9d79704a0e"
-
 [[package]]
 name = "convert_case"
 version = "0.6.0"
@@ -566,14 +560,21 @@ dependencies = [
 
 [[package]]
 name = "derive_more"
-version = "0.99.18"
+version = "1.0.0"
+source = "registry+https://github.com/rust-lang/crates.io-index"
+checksum = "4a9b99b9cbbe49445b21764dc0625032a89b145a2642e67603e1c936f5458d05"
+dependencies = [
+ "derive_more-impl",
+]
+
+[[package]]
+name = "derive_more-impl"
+version = "1.0.0"
 source = "registry+https://github.com/rust-lang/crates.io-index"
-checksum = "5f33878137e4dafd7fa914ad4e259e18a4e8e532b9617a2d0150262bf53abfce"
+checksum = "cb7330aeadfbe296029522e6c40f315320aba36fc43a5b3632f3795348f3bd22"
 dependencies = [
- "convert_case 0.4.0",
  "proc-macro2",
  "quote",
- "rustc_version",
  "syn 2.0.72",
 ]
 
@@ -633,7 +634,7 @@ dependencies = [
  "cached",
  "cast",
  "chrono",
- "convert_case 0.6.0",
+ "convert_case",
  "counter",
  "criterion",
  "crossbeam",
@@ -1142,9 +1143,9 @@ dependencies = [
 
 [[package]]
 name = "indexmap"
-version = "2.3.0"
+version = "2.4.0"
 source = "registry+https://github.com/rust-lang/crates.io-index"
-checksum = "de3fc2e30ba82dd1b3911c8de1ffc143c74a914a14e99514d7637e3099df5ea0"
+checksum = "93ead53efc7ea8ed3cfb0c79fc8023fbb782a5432b52830b6518941cebe6505c"
 dependencies = [
  "equivalent",
  "hashbrown 0.14.5",
@@ -1378,14 +1379,16 @@ checksum = "ce8738c9ddd350996cb8b8b718192851df960803764bcdaa3afb44a63b1ddb5c"
 
 [[package]]
 name = "ndarray"
-version = "0.15.6"
+version = "0.16.1"
 source = "registry+https://github.com/rust-lang/crates.io-index"
-checksum = "adb12d4e967ec485a5f71c6311fe28158e9d6f4bc4a447b474184d0f91a8fa32"
+checksum = "882ed72dce9365842bf196bdeedf5055305f11fc8c03dee7bb0194a6cad34841"
 dependencies = [
  "matrixmultiply",
  "num-complex 0.4.6",
  "num-integer",
  "num-traits",
+ "portable-atomic",
+ "portable-atomic-util",
  "rawpointer",
 ]
 
@@ -1735,6 +1738,21 @@ dependencies = [
  "plotters-backend",
 ]
 
+[[package]]
+name = "portable-atomic"
+version = "1.7.0"
+source = "registry+https://github.com/rust-lang/crates.io-index"
+checksum = "da544ee218f0d287a911e9c99a39a8c9bc8fcad3cb8db5959940044ecfc67265"
+
+[[package]]
+name = "portable-atomic-util"
+version = "0.2.2"
+source = "registry+https://github.com/rust-lang/crates.io-index"
+checksum = "fcdd8420072e66d54a407b3316991fe946ce3ab1083a7f575b2463866624704d"
+dependencies = [
+ "portable-atomic",
+]
+
 [[package]]
 name = "powerfmt"
 version = "0.2.0"
@@ -2016,9 +2034,9 @@ checksum = "ba39f3699c378cd8970968dcbff9c43159ea4cfbd88d43c00b22f2ef10a435d2"
 
 [[package]]
 name = "rstest"
-version = "0.21.0"
+version = "0.22.0"
 source = "registry+https://github.com/rust-lang/crates.io-index"
-checksum = "9afd55a67069d6e434a95161415f5beeada95a01c7b815508a82dcb0e1593682"
+checksum = "7b423f0e62bdd61734b67cd21ff50871dfaeb9cc74f869dcd6af974fbcb19936"
 dependencies = [
  "futures",
  "futures-timer",
@@ -2028,9 +2046,9 @@ dependencies = [
 
 [[package]]
 name = "rstest_macros"
-version = "0.21.0"
+version = "0.22.0"
 source = "registry+https://github.com/rust-lang/crates.io-index"
-checksum = "4165dfae59a39dd41d8dec720d3cbfbc71f69744efb480a3920f5d4e0cc6798d"
+checksum = "c5e1711e7d14f74b12a58411c542185ef7fb7f2e7f8ee6e2940a883628522b42"
 dependencies = [
  "cfg-if",
  "glob",
@@ -2124,18 +2142,18 @@ checksum = "61697e0a1c7e512e84a621326239844a24d8207b4669b41bc18b32ea5cbf988b"
 
 [[package]]
 name = "serde"
-version = "1.0.204"
+version = "1.0.208"
 source = "registry+https://github.com/rust-lang/crates.io-index"
-checksum = "bc76f558e0cbb2a839d37354c575f1dc3fdc6546b5be373ba43d95f231bf7c12"
+checksum = "cff085d2cb684faa248efb494c39b68e522822ac0de72ccf08109abde717cfb2"
 dependencies = [
  "serde_derive",
 ]
 
 [[package]]
 name = "serde_derive"
-version = "1.0.204"
+version = "1.0.208"
 source = "registry+https://github.com/rust-lang/crates.io-index"
-checksum = "e0cd7e117be63d3c3678776753929474f3b04a43a080c744d6b0ae2a8c28e222"
+checksum = "24008e81ff7613ed8e5ba0cfaf24e2c2f1e5b8a0495711e44fcd4882fca62bcf"
 dependencies = [
  "proc-macro2",
  "quote",
diff --git a/local-registry/Cargo.toml b/local-registry/Cargo.toml
index 3b11bf4..bac11a9 100644
--- a/local-registry/Cargo.toml
+++ b/local-registry/Cargo.toml
@@ -8,7 +8,7 @@ path = "dummy.rs"
 
 [dependencies]
 anyhow = "1.0.86"
-arrayvec = "0.7.4"
+arrayvec = "0.7.6"
 arr_macro = "0.2.1"
 ascii = "1.1.0"
 bigdecimal = "0.4.5"
@@ -29,7 +29,7 @@ crossbeam = "0.8.4"
 crossbeam-channel = "0.5.13"
 crossbeam-utils = "0.8.20"
 dashmap = "6.0.1"
-derive_more = "0.99.18"
+derive_more = "1.0.0"
 digits_iterator = "0.1.0"
 divisors = "0.2.1"
 divrem = "1.0.0"
@@ -47,7 +47,7 @@ hashbag = "0.1.12"
 hexlit = "0.5.5"
 if_chain = "1.0.2"
 im = "15.1.0"
-indexmap = "2.3.0"
+indexmap = "2.4.0"
 indoc = "2.0.5"
 integer-sqrt = "0.1.5"
 int-enum = "1.1.2"
@@ -62,7 +62,7 @@ mod_exp = "1.0.1"
 modinverse = "0.1.1"
 multimap = "0.10.0"
 multiset = "0.0.5"
-ndarray = "0.15.6"
+ndarray = "0.16.1"
 nom = "7.1.3"
 num = "0.4.3"
 num-bigint = "0.4.6"
@@ -85,9 +85,9 @@ rand = "0.8.5"
 rand_chacha = "0.3.1"
 rayon = "1.10.0"
 regex-lite = "0.1.6"
-rstest = "0.21.0"
+rstest = "0.22.0"
 rstest_reuse = "0.7.0"
-serde = "1.0.204"
+serde = "1.0.208"
 serde_derive = "1.0.173"
 spinning_top = "0.3.0"
 static_assertions = "1.1.0"